CEILING JOIST INSTALLATION METAL FITTING, AND SEISMIC REINFORCEMENT STRUCTURE FOR CEILING JOIST
PROBLEM TO BE SOLVED: To provide a seismic reinforcement structure for a ceiling joist capable of seismically reinforcing a ceiling joist holder 3 by enhancing rigidity strength against torsion and deformation by bending of an installation metal fitting 6a on an opening side of the ceiling joist holder even when the installation metal fitting 6a is less in assembly seismic strength compared to an installation metal fitting 6b on a side surface side of the ceiling joist holder, and by having a reinforcing piece 64 for ceiling joist holder firmly hold and support compressive vibration load in an inward direction at top and bottom ends of the reinforcing piece and preventing deformation by bending of the ceiling joist holder for certain, even when the ceiling joist holder 3 is exposed to a vibration load that compresses an opening side thereof in a vertical direction.SOLUTION: A reinforcing piece 64 for a ceiling joist that is bent for insertion into an opening of a ceiling joist holder 3 is formed on both ends of a ceiling joist holder fitting part 61 of an installation metal fitting 6a on an opening side of the ceiling joist holder disposed on the opening side of the ceiling joist holder 3 for holding and regulating a compressive vibration load in an inward direction on top and bottom surfaces on the opening side of the ceiling joist holder 3 at top and bottom ends of the reinforcing piece, thereby seismically reinforcing the ceiling joist holder 3.SELECTED DRAWING: Figure 6
